Coupang Play's K-drama 'UDT: Our Neighborhood Special Forces' Episode 6 dives deep into the mysterious disappearance of PD Kim, uncovering a web of political intrigue and the full integration of the elite UDT team. The episode heightens suspense with the recovery of a button camera and the introduction of a shadowy figure, James Sullivan, setting the stage for a gripping political thriller.
UDT: Our Neighborhood Special Forces Ep 6: The Start of PD Kim's Disappearance
The episode opens with a tense scene as 'Jeong Hwan' discovers PD Kim's office in disarray: an overturned desk, a severed phone line, and crucially, missing CCTV footage and hard drives. These deliberate acts of evidence tampering point to a planned operation, not a simple missing person case. Meanwhile, Kim Seok Jun begins his own investigation, ordering his subordinates to gather all profiles on the 'Neighborhood Special Forces,' hinting at a larger conspiracy. The plot thickens when a report reveals that 'Choi Kang' was involved in PD Kim's extraction, escalating the stakes.
Simultaneously, in a subterranean bunker, Lee Geun Chul formally introduces Lieutenant Soo Jin Lee to the team, marking her official integration. He also reveals that the explosion in Gi-yun City involved military supplies, a critical clue suggesting military involvement in the unfolding events. This revelation helps Nam Yeon and Byeong Nam piece together why the military might be implicated in each incident.
Button Camera Recovery and the Political Chess Match
Choi Kang attempts to track PD Kim's location using a button camera he planted on a mercenary's jacket during a previous skirmish. While the GPS is offline, he hopes to recover the last known data. The team's operational strategy is simplified: 'Reconnaissance by day, infiltration by night.' On the political front, tensions rise. Lee Geun Chul probes Kim Seok Jun about alleged defense industry corruption, catching him off guard. A flustered Kim Seok Jun turns to Na Eun Jae for a solution, who in turn attempts to pressure the National Assembly Speaker to declare Gi-yun City a special disaster zone. However, the introduction of James Sullivan, a mysterious figure involved in political maneuvering, adds a new layer of complexity.
He presents a cryptic business card, foreshadowing significant future developments and raising questions about his role in the unfolding events.
Mi Kyung's Approval and Choi Kang's Full Integration
The atmosphere shifts as the team prepares for a critical mission. At the Changri Market, Mi Kyung shares a lingering glance with Choi Kang, hinting at a deeper connection. Choi Kang's thoughts are clearly elsewhere, preoccupied with the mission and his interactions with Nam Yeon. Ultimately, Mi Kyung grants her approval, allowing Choi Kang to join the operation. Later, during a reconnaissance mission, Choi Kang is deployed into a dangerous situation, turning the tide of the battle. This critical intervention, coupled with Nam Yeon securing the original button camera footage, signifies the UDT team's complete and unified operational status.
The Ominous Ending and James Sullivan's Threat
The episode concludes with a chilling cliffhanger. James Sullivan, the enigmatic figure, appears in the vicinity of Mi Kyung and Do Yeon, extending his reach of fear directly into their home. This personal threat suggests that the political machinations are now bleeding into the personal lives of the team members and their families, raising the stakes dramatically for the upcoming episodes. The UDT team must now confront not only external threats but also the encroaching danger to their loved ones.
